Genes involved in DNA repair, cell-cycle control and cell death have key roles in cancer progression.

The same genetic pathways mutated somatically in cancer progression often have how does genetics works mutations that increase predisposition to cancer. The rare occurrence of new mutations and the common elimination of highly penetrant, early onset mutations by natural selection cause severe predisposition for early onset cancer to be infrequent. Most inherited effects on cancer predisposition arise from how does genetics works combination of many different mutations, each mutation having only a small effect on the tendency to develop cancer.

Families that show predisposition to cancer might start further along how does genetics works sequence of stages in cancer progression than other families, perhaps because they inherit certain mutations that must be acquired somatically in other families.

The normal mechanisms that regulate cell proliferation and cell death provide robust protection against cancer. Such robustness also protects against deleterious mutations and allows cancer-predisposing mutations to increase in frequency. Individuals differ in their inherited tendency to develop cancer. Major single-gene defects that cause early cancer onset have been known for many years from their inheritance patterns, what are the 5 major types of infectious agents inherited defects that have weaker effects on predisposition were how does genetics works suspected to exist.

Recent progress in cancer genetics has how does genetics works specific loci that are involved in cancer progression, many of which have key roles in DNA repair, cell-cycle control and cell-death pathways. Those loci, which are often mutated somatically during cancer progression, sometimes also contain inherited mutations. Recent genetic studies and quantitative population-genetic analyses provide a framework for understanding the frequency of inherited mutations and the consequences of these mutations for increased predisposition to cancer.
